    <description>Two principal issues arise: whether an articles provision (Article 45) can impose an independent contractual liability to pay &quot;moneys owing&quot; at the date of forfeiture even if the remedy is time-barred, and whether an allotment made after more than a year without notice is binding. The note concludes that &quot;money owing&quot; may denote an existing debt irrespective of legal recoverability, so Article 45 can create independent liability; and that an allotment made after an unreasonable delay without notice is repudiable and does not bind the applicant, rendering any consequent forfeiture ineffective.</description>
